Technical field
The present invention relates to compound voice diaphragm preparing technical field, especially a kind of annulus automatic ordering machine.
Background technology
The making of compound voice diaphragm and the synthesis of compound voice diaphragm component are being made generally using hot-press forming device, that is, make-up machine When making compound voice diaphragm, need sound film being pressed together on circular (being typically copper ring) gasket, the stamped molding of annulus gasket, punching press For annulus afterwards in stamping surface in arc surfaced, the back side of stamping surface is in planar, is needing distinguishing annulus just when closing with sound membrane pressure Face (cambered surface) and reverse side (plane).
Existing compound voice diaphragm is when making, it usually needs after the positive and negative of artificial naked eyes identification copper ring, according still further to predetermined Direction be placed in one by one in the press back on mold, hand labor intensity is big, and production efficiency is relatively low.

The present invention proposes a kind of annulus automatic ordering machine.
With reference to Fig. 1, in an embodiment of the present invention, annulus automatic ordering machine includes pedestal 1, distribution grid 2 and distributor 3, Wherein:
Pedestal 1 is used to support distribution grid 2 and distributor 3;To mitigate weight and saving material, pedestal 1 uses stent-type Structure or hollow structure, the pedestal 1 in the present embodiment include bottom plate 11 and vertically-arranged the riser 12 on four angles of bottom plate.
The distribution grid 2 is connected on the pedestal 1, and upper surface has several recess 10 for being used to place annulus;It is described Recess 10 forms the parallel recess groups of several columns by row arrangement;Distribution grid 2 can be fixedly connected on pedestal 1 by connector, Can also be hinged on by axis pin on the pedestal 1,10 depth of being recessed is equal or slightly larger than the thickness of annulus, row here to It is rectilinear direction;The line at 10 center of recess of each column recess groups is linear, and with arrange it is parallel to direction, recess 10 between Away from may be the same or different.
The distributor 3, including slide 31 and the more storages for being used to store the annulus being arranged on the slide 31 Expects pipe 32, the every storing pipe 32 correspond to the row recess (a row recess groups in other words), the bottom of the storing pipe 32 Portion is respectively positioned in the slide 31, and the gap between 2 upper surface of 32 bottom of storing pipe and the distribution grid is less than described The thickness of annulus, the internal diameter of the saving pipe 32 is identical with the outer diameter of the annulus, and the slide 31 under external force can be The row of recess groups described in 2 upper edge of distribution grid are to slip and pass through all recess.
Recess 10 is according to row to arrangement, and 31 Relative distribution plate 2 of slide is arranged to movement, and a storing pipe 32 is moved with slide 31 Kinetic energy it is enough to this row to all recess 10 put annulus, multiple storing pipes 32 just can put multiple row annulus, and slide 31 can be with It is directly placed on distribution grid 2, is placed on distribution grid 2 by own wt, 31 Relative distribution plates 2 are slided further to accurately define Motion track, can be connected between slide 31 and distribution grid 2 by sliding equipment, can also be by position-limit mechanism to slide 31 Moving direction be defined.Storing pipe 32 can be fixedly connected with slide 31, can also be flexibly connected, such as in slide 31 If jack, storing pipe 32 is inserted directly into jack, can also be threadedly coupled.
Annulus automatic ordering machine provided by the invention, in use, first by the super upper loading of annulus cambered surface of point good positive and negative In each storing pipe 32, slide 31 is located at preceding stop, the pressing position 30 at 31 both ends of both hands flicking slide, and is slided backward along arranging to pushing Seat 31, reaching rear stop, the rapid slide 31 of promotion forward arrives preceding stop again;In 31 first time of slide by being used on distribution grid 2 When placing the recess 10 of annulus, the annulus in every storing pipe 31 falls into each recess of same row successively under self gravitation effect In 10, more storing pipes 31 complete the wobble ring of all recess 10 on distribution grid 2, and slide 31, which again passes by, places circle on distribution grid 2 During the recess 10 of ring, due to recess 10 in had been filled with annulus, be recessed 10 depth it is suitable with the thickness of annulus, annulus with storage Gap between 32 bottom of expects pipe is not enough to accommodate an annulus, therefore annulus will not be fallen again, but with slide 31 or storage Expects pipe 32 moves together;Primary property annulus can be all put directly on mold, completion can also be put on distribution grid 2 Afterwards, mold is had to one side and the annulus on distribution grid 2 of press back to after just, all annulus being all turned in mold, phase To the prior art, this programme reduces hand labor intensity, substantially increases wobble ring efficiency, so as to improve the life of compound voice diaphragm Produce efficiency.
Preferably, it is arranged to accurately define slide 31 in 2 upper edge of distribution grid to linear movement, the two of the distribution grid 2 Side has for limiting the row of 31 moving direction of slide to limit protrusion 21, and the both ends of the distribution grid 2 have to limit The row of fixed 31 stroke stop point of slide prevents from overexerting, slide 31 comes off from distribution grid 2 to limit protrusion 22.Arrange to Limit protrusion 21, row are fixed to limit protrusion 22 with 2 position of distribution grid, can be integrally formed, can also be connected by connector Connect, in the present embodiment, distribution grid 2 is square, and arranges to for length direction, row to for width direction, arrange to limit protrusion 21, row to Limit protrusion 22 is located at rectangular 2 edge of distribution grid and the first connection.
Preferably, there are several columns referring to Fig. 1, on the distribution grid 2 to groove 23, each row recess groups are respectively positioned on Adjacent two described arrange between groove 23;On the slide 31 have at least two arrange to protrusion 33, two it is described arrange to protrusion 33 In 31 both ends of slide, it is each it is described arrange to convex 33 correspondences be positioned over one it is described arrange into groove 23, all storing pipes 32 In two it is described arrange to protrusion 33 between.The row of slide 31 are limited to straight line with arranging the cooperation to groove 23 to protrusion 33 by row Motion track, the internal row without cooperation row to protrusion 33 can provide reference to 23 one side of groove for the setting of recess groups, On the other hand reduce distribution grid 2 and the contact area of 21 bottom of slide, the movement on distribution grid 2 of slide 31 is more smoothly.
As a kind of preferred structure of above-described embodiment, arrange and be equal to the quantity of protrusion 33 with the quantity arranged to groove 23, It is each it is described arrange to convex 33 correspondences be positioned over one it is described arrange into groove 23, the every storing pipe 32 is located at adjacent two institute Row are stated between protrusion 33.Arrange the mobile side on the one hand further limiting slide 31 with the structure arranged to groove 23 to protrusion 33 To the accuracy of the moving direction of raising slide 31 is on the other hand, anti-by each independent separated carry out wobble ring of row recess Only adjacent two row annulus collects together position during putting, and improves wobble ring accuracy.

Action process is as follows:
After slide 31 is pushed to complete wobble ring on distribution grid 2, slide 31 is located at the fixation panel 24 close to 1 top of pedestal On, by template being placed on one side on drop front 25 with press back, the both sides of mold are just placed in two row between protrusion, mold Both ends are aligned with the lower edges of drop front 25, and recess 10 is just overlapped with the press back on mold, will be living by connection component Dynamic panel 25 links together with mold, then again by the two together around axis pin 27 to the outer side to overturn 180 degree of drop front 25, Mold is located at lower section at this time, and drop front 25 is located above, and in order to facilitate the operation, can set support base (figure on the table Do not show) support base of the template is used to support, the support base is located at the side of the pedestal 1, and close to the active face The side hinged with fixed panel 24 of plate 25, by shuttering supporting on support base after, connection component 4 is loosened, by drop front 25 Negative direction overturning 180 degree is placed on pedestal 1, waits for wobble ring next time, directly film to be processed is covered on mold, is put It is placed on molding machine and carries out the compound of annulus and film.
In above-described embodiment, the connection component 4 includes mounting blocks 41, screw 42, clamping cap 43;Wherein:
Mounting blocks 41 are mounted on the side of the drop front 25 by fastener, and 41 top surface of mounting blocks is arranged with described to limit The top surface of position protrusion 21 is generally aligned in the same plane or higher than the top surface arranged to limit protrusion 21;Facilitate the behaviour of clamping cap 43 Make, and simplify the structure of clamping cap 43;
Screw 42 is threadedly coupled the mounting blocks 41 and clamping cap;
Clamping cap 43, on the mounting blocks 41, and one end far from the screw 42 has for institute The crowning 430 stated the precession of screw and contradicted with template, the crowning 430 is towards 25 top surface of drop front.
Specific operation process is as follows:
Template is placed on distribution grid 2, and clamping cap 43 is placed in template by rotating mould pressing plate 43, from a sidespin Turn the nut of screw 42 so that the crowning 430 of clamping cap 43 is tightly bonded with template back surface, 180 degree overturning drop front 25 and template, negative direction rotary nut, clamping cap 43 is unclamped with template, and ring is turned in negative direction overturning drop front 25, completion.Knot Structure is simple, easily operated.
For convenience of the installation of storing pipe 32 and slide 31, there are several stepped holes 310 on the slide 31, wherein described Aperture (stepped hole miner diameter end 312) in rank hole 310 close to the distribution grid 2 is identical with the annulus outer diameter, the stepped hole The aperture (stepped hole bigger diameter end 311) far from the distribution grid 2 is identical with the outer diameter of the storing pipe 32 in 310.Here phase With referring to macro-size, not including the fit dimension on microcosmic, stepped hole bigger diameter end 311 and 32 outer diameter of storing pipe here it Between, between 32 internal diameter of annulus and storing pipe and between annulus and stepped hole miner diameter end 312 be clearance fit so that circle Ring smooth progress during putting.
For the ease of the number of rings inside observation storing pipe 32, the storing pipe is made of transparent material.In annulus number When measuring less, annulus can be internally added in real time.
In order to facilitate the gap between adjustment 31 bottom surface of slide and distribution grid 2, the slide 31 is square, the slide 31 Four angles on respectively by screw be equipped with adjustment cushion block 34, it is described adjustment cushion block 34 be located at the distribution grid 2 and the cunning Between seat 31.Adjusting has counterbore or axle sleeve on cushion block 34, screw bottom is placed in counterbore or in axle sleeve, screw and 31 spiral shell of slide Line connects, and the screw on rotary carriage 31 is the adjustable length stretched out from 31 bottom of slide, so as to adjust 31 bottom surface of slide and Gap between distribution grid 2.
